More than 9 years after the conflict, the people of Sri Lanka are still struggling to rebuild their country's democratic institutions but also obtain justice for the crimes that were committed during the conflict.
Said by
John Sifton

Editor's note · Context

Highlighting ongoing struggles in Sri Lanka for democracy and justice post-conflict.
